Heartbreak and desperation have gripped Drake Family Farms California after a ruthless theft stole the joy from their family-run dairy farm. In the wee hours of Monday morning, the cold-hearted thief or thieves invaded the farm, cutting the fence under the cloak of darkness.

Precious Lives Vanished

With each snip of the wire, the thieves extinguished the dreams of the Drake family. They skillfully selected and stole 12 innocent goats, leaving behind a void that can’t be easily filled.

  • 7 pregnant goats brimming with promise
  • 1 goat that gave birth mere hours before the heinous theft
  • 1 goat that welcomed her little ones within 24 hours of being stolen
  • 3 adorable baby goats, their innocence torn away in an instant

In a cruel twist of fate, two baby goats born to the stolen mother were left behind, their cries echoing through the farm’s empty fields.

Waves of Despair

The farm is consumed by a wave of despair, with the stolen goats representing the heart and soul of their livelihood. “She needed her Dextrose [Tuesday] morning and is probably dead now,” the farm’s heart-wrenching Instagram post revealed. The realization that precious lives may have been lost weighs heavily on their minds.

The Chase for Justice

Determined to find the culprits and bring them to justice, the Drake family is combing through security footage, hoping for a glimpse of the heartless thieves. Authorities have been notified, and the search for the stolen goats has intensified.

Call for Witnesses

The farm desperately appeals for the public’s help in finding their beloved animals. Anyone with any information, no matter how small, is urged to contact the Ontario Police Department.
